About the job: System Administration Engineer

Our client is a holding company in Al Khobar, Saudi Arabia, and is hiring for the position of System Administration Engineer.

Location: Al Khobar, Saudi Arabia

Experience: Minimum 3 years in a similar role

Education: Bachelor's degree in System/Computer Engineering

Salary: Competitive

Notice period: Immediate joiners or maximum one month notice period

Responsibilities:
  1. Maintain essential IT operations, including operating systems, security tools, applications, servers, email systems, cloud infrastructure, SaaS solutions, software, and hardware.
  2. Perform server administration tasks such as user/group management, security permissions, group policies, print services, event log analysis, and resource monitoring to ensure seamless system architecture.
  3. Monitor data center health using management tools, respond to hardware/software issues, and assist in building, testing, and maintaining servers.
  4. Conduct routine audits and health checks of systems including MS AD, Azure, Office 365, VMware, and backups.
  5. Apply problem-solving skills and think algorithmically to resolve issues efficiently.
  6. Maintain internal infrastructure including servers, storage, virtualization, disaster recovery, and security updates.
  7. Install and upgrade hardware and software, manage virtual servers, and automate processes where possible.
  8. Provide documentation and technical specifications for planning and upgrades of IT infrastructure.
  9. Perform or oversee backup operations, ensuring data protection, disaster recovery, and failover procedures.
  10. Manage capacity planning, storage, and database performance.

Overview

Abacus Technology is seeking a Network Administrator to manage and maintain network infrastructure in a dynamic, mission-critical environment under the US Military Training Mission (USMTM). This full-time position in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ia.

Responsibilities

Network Administration:

  • Administer, install, configure, troubleshoot, test, and maintain network-related hardware, including HAIPE encryption devices, switches, routers, and transport devices.
  • Utilize network monitoring and management tools to proactively identify, troubleshoot, and resolve performance issues.
  • Demonstrated experience in overseeing and troubleshooting complex Local Area Networking (LAN) issues.
  • Configure, deploy, and manage switch stacking solutions, including Cisco StackWise and StackWise Virtual Link (SVL) technologies
  • Implement and troubleshoot Layer 2 network solutions, including VLAN configuration, trunking, spanning-tree protocol (STP), and inter-switch connectivity.
  • Configure and manage TACLANE encryptors with the Agile-VLAN feature to enable simultaneous transmission of Layer 2 and High Assurance Internet Protocol Encryptor (HAIPE) traffic, enhancing network flexibility and efficiency.
  • Implement and manage 802.1X port-based network access control to ensure secure user authentication and device validation. Configure and troubleshoot MAC Authentication Bypass (MAB) for non-802.1X-compliant devices, ensuring seamless network access while maintaining security standards.
  • Utilize NetFlow to monitor and analyze network traffic patterns, identify bottlenecks, and detect potential security threats.
  • Configure and manage Quality of Service (QoS) policies at the access layer to prioritize critical traffic such as voice, video, and real-time applications.

Collaboration and Troubleshooting:

  • Coordinate with offsite service providers (e.g., WAN, Voice, WANSEC) via Remedy/Service Now ticketing system to resolve issues with DMZs, boundary routers/switches, Cisco CUBE, firewalls, IDS/IPS, VPN concentrators, and encryption devices.
  • Work with local base operations teams (e.g., help desk, systems, ISP/OSP) to address outages, ensuring timely restoration per established SLAs.
  • Troubleshoot and coordinate VTC (Video Teleconferencing) outages with offsite bridge personnel.

Performance Optimization and Upgrades:

  • Perform performance monitoring, tuning, IOS upgrades, patching, backup and recovery, and problem resolution for network and voice routers/switches.
  • Actively participate in the planning and design of infrastructure upgrades or enhancements.

Voice and Video Systems

  • Collaborate with the Voice Engineer to troubleshoot, configure, and maintain voice and video systems, ensuring seamless communication services.
  • Assist with the deployment, testing, and optimization of voice and video-related hardware and software as required.
  • Provide supplementary support during outages or upgrades to ensure minimal downtime

Risk Management and Compliance:

  • Assist in building, maintaining, and updating Risk Management Framework (RMF) Assessment and Authorization to Operate (ATO) packages for two ARCENT Cyber Security-administered enclaves.
  • Ensure compliance with DISA Security Technical Implementation Guides (STIGs), Security Content Automation Protocol (SCAP) scans, and other Security Requirements Guidance.

Documentation and Reporting:

  • Proficient in developing and maintaining detailed network diagrams, schematics, and documentation using Microsoft Visio or similar application to ensure accurate representation of the infrastructure.
  • Assist in developing and completing system security documentation in accordance with RMF and eMASS workflows.
  • Identify and report system risks related to network and voice hardware/software.

Asset Management:

  • Maintain inventory and manage life cycle replacement schedules for network infrastructure.
Qualifications

4+ years experience in core network services connectivity and integration. Must be Security+ and CCNA certified. CCNP certification desired. Able to adhere to a disciplined troubleshooting methodology, and ensure task/mission completion, along with creating and maintaining necessary information. Able to apply DoD and industry best practices, concerning daily network operations. Able to analyze complex inputs and translate data into well-defined system requirements. Comfortable interacting heavily with outside organizations, clients and end users to assess current state of systems and architecture, as well as future needs. Able to apply DoD and industry best practices, concerning daily network operations. Must have strong written and verbal communication skills. Must be willing to work outside of normal business hours as needed to support unexpected issues or planned projects. Must have a valid driver’s license. Must be a US citizen, hold a current Secret clearance, and be willing to live and work in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ia.
